What is the look-back period for compliance with the Cream franchise agreement before a franchisee can give notice of election to acquire a successor franchise?

Cream Franchise · 2025 FDD

Answer from 2025 FDD Document

  • (6) you and your owners have not violated any provision of this Agreement or any other agreement with us or our affiliates during both the 60-day period before you give us written notice of your election to acquire a successor franchise and on the date on which the term of the successor franchise commences, in full compliance with this Agreement including that you have paid all Royalties, Brand Fund Contributions, and other amounts owed to us, our affiliates, and third-party suppliers, and have submitted all required reports and statements;

Source: Item 23 — RECEIPTS (FDD pages 61–192)

What This Means (2025 FDD)

According to the 2025 FDD, a Cream franchisee must be in compliance with the franchise agreement during a specific period before they can give notice of their intent to acquire a successor franchise. Specifically, the franchisee and their owners must not have violated any provision of the agreement or any other agreement with Cream or its affiliates during the 60-day period before giving written notice of their election to acquire a successor franchise.

Furthermore, compliance must extend to the date on which the term of the successor franchise commences. This includes being in full compliance with the agreement, having paid all royalties, brand fund contributions, and other amounts owed to Cream, its affiliates, and third-party suppliers, and having submitted all required reports and statements.

In practical terms, this means a Cream franchisee needs to ensure they are fully compliant with all aspects of the franchise agreement for at least 60 days before notifying Cream of their intention to renew, and they must maintain this compliance up to the start date of the new franchise term. Failure to meet these conditions could result in Cream denying the renewal of the franchise agreement.
